Contract Lifecycle Management (CLM) System Oversight
- Manage the implementation of and subsequently oversee and maintain the firm’s CLM system to ensure agreements are reviewed, approved, and archived in accordance with firm policies.
- Support continuous improvement of legal operations by optimizing the intake process and workflow automation.
Legal Agreements & Corporate Filings
- Create, edit, revise, redline, and proofread documents. Draft/formal legal documents and correspondence.
- Manage all entity management activities, including entity formations, registrations, annual renewals, and state filings.
Regulatory Compliance Support
- Assist with preparation and maintenance of regulatory filings (e.g., Form ADV, state registrations, and related disclosures).
- Review the firm’s marketing content for compliance with applicable laws and regulations.
- Develop and maintain written policies and processes for the Legal and Compliance team.
- Develop testing procedures of firm data in accordance with regulations and provide results and recommendations to senior leadership.
Insurance Administration
- Oversee routine requirements of the firm’s insurance portfolio and program, coordinating with internal and external stakeholders.
- Manage the preparation for annual insurance renewals, including gathering documentation from different business stakeholders and completing applications, under attorney supervision.
Project Management & Cross-Functional Collaboration
- Support teams across the firm, providing flexible and timely support on tasks and projects.
- Present and communicate issues in a clear, concise and effective manner to technical and non-technical audiences.
